If this is a bonafide need, I would suggest that this person consider
surrendering this ferret. If she is trying to raise money before
getting any treatment, the poor baby is suffering in the meantime.
Also, the longer the leg is not dealt with, the greater the chances
it can't be fixed properly.

Another example that every pet owner should have a bank account for
such emergencies, and a good working relationship with their vet.
